The function of the direct-melting fiber distribution box

A Direct Melting Fiber Distribution Box is designed to efficiently manage, protect, and distribute optical fibers while enabling single-person installation and improved operational safety.Core FunctionThe Direct Melting Fiber Distribution Box serves as a central point for terminating, splicing, and distributing optical fibers in a network. Unlike conventional fiber distribution boxes, it incorporates a direct fusion (melting) mechanism that simplifies fiber connections, reduces manpower requirements, and enhances installation efficiency . This design allows one person to install or disassemble the box, which traditionally required two people, thereby improving work efficiency and reducing labor costs .Key Features and AdvantagesFiber Protection and Organization: The box includes splice trays and protective tubes to secure spliced fibers, preventing mechanical damage and minimizing signal loss .Enhanced Safety: Elastic members and protective top plates prevent accidental damage during installation or maintenance, ensuring the safety of both the fibers and the installer .Ease of Installation: The integrated support slides and limit baffles allow the box to be mounted and disassembled quickly, making it suitable for both indoor and outdoor applications .Durability: Constructed from weather-resistant materials, the box withstands environmental factors such as moisture, dust, and temperature fluctuations, similar to standard fiber distribution boxes .Integration with Optical Splitters: The box can house optical splitters, enabling efficient branching and distribution of optical signals to multiple endpoints, which is essential for FTTH (Fiber to the Home) and other access networks .Operational ContextIn a fiber optic network, the direct melting fiber distribution box functions as a junction point between backbone cables and distribution cables, facilitating signal branching and network expansion. It is commonly used in FTTH networks, telecommunication systems, and data communication networks, where reliable fiber management and minimal signal loss are critical . Its design supports both wall-mounted and pole-mounted installations, making it versatile for various deployment scenarios .SummaryThe Direct Melting Fiber Distribution Box improves upon traditional fiber distribution boxes by combining efficient fiber management, enhanced safety, and simplified installation. Its direct fusion capability reduces labor requirements, ensures secure fiber connections, and supports network scalability, making it a vital component in modern optical fiber networks .
